Subject Matter Expertise and Successful Teaching →
34years: This topic is dear to me. I have had this conversation with a colleague several times over the last couple of years. He contends there is no correlation between advanced degrees and successful teaching. I contend that may be true to an extent, but more knowledge, whether it is subject matter or pedagogical knowledge, can never be a bad thing. What I do know is that the pedagogical...

NY TIMES: White House Issues Long-Delayed Science... →
The Obama administration issued long-awaited, long-delayed guidelines on Friday to insulate government scientific research from political meddling and to base policy decisions on solid data. Under the guidelines, government scientists are in general free to speak to journalists and the public about their work, and agencies are prohibited from editing or suppressing reports by independent...

Visual Thesaurus - Spelling Bee →
In the Tournament Spelling Bee, you’ll be challenged by a series of words, with the spelling difficulty adapted to your skill level. The more words you get right, the higher your score will go, on a scale from 200 to 800. You can compete against other spellers, since we keep track of high scores (with streaks of correct answers serving as tiebreakers).

Veterans History Project →
The Veterans History Project began in 2000 for the purpose of documenting the lives of American WWII Veterans. Later, the project was expanded to any veteran on active duty or who has served in any branch of the Armed Services in any era. Your mission is to interview a veteran, present their narrative in a multimedia presentation, and share it. If it is good enough, the interview and the...
